Aquila Rithymna Beach Hotel becomes an Advocate for ARCHELON in Rethymno
ARCHELON is pleased to announce that Aquila Rithymna Beach has become a leading supporter of the Rethymno Sea Turtle Conservation Project, choosing the "Sustainable Tourism Advocate" category. The hotel's generous donation directly supports the costs of conservation activities during the 2025 and 2026 nesting seasons.
A commitment to sustainability is at the core of ARCHELON's efforts. This year we approached hotels along Rethymno beach to seek partners in funding the actions to protect the loggerhead sea turtle (Caretta caretta). This initiative directly enables businesses to contribute to the preservation of the local ecosystem that makes their destination so attractive.
ARCHELON's project in Rethymno brings together volunteers, local communities, and the tourism sector to create a cohesive network for sustainable tourism. In 2025, the Rethymno Project managed to protect hundreds of nests, despite intense human activity on the beaches. They trained hotel staff, raised awareness among visitors from all over the world, and invited children and adults to discover the magic of nature just a few steps from their sun loungers.
ARCHELON representatives recently met with the hotel's staff and management to officially hand over the Certificate of Support. "Our good relationship with Aquila Rithymna Beach dates back in the 1990s and has already played a vital role in protecting turtle nests in the area for all these years," says Giorgos Vrampas, ARCHELON's Project Manager in Rethymno. This effort proves that sea turtle protection is more than conservation action; it's a living example of how sustainable tourism can be achieved.
